Favor flora or fresh veggies? Dig into urban gardening

As the Pacific Northwest soil begins to warm enough to support an explosion of new growth, May is the perfect time to think about gardening. Whether your passions run toward geraniums, dahlias and foxglove or tomatoes, blueberries and zucchini—or maybe all of the above—our region is a pretty ideal place to sow your seeds and [...]

Celebrate AANHPI Heritage Month

May is National Asian American, Native Hawai’ian and Pacific Islander (AANHPI) Heritage Month, an opportunity to celebrate the diverse people, cultures and communities whose contributions have greatly enriched American history, society and culture. The United States first recognized AANHPI heritage in 1978. A week-long recognition was extended to a month-long celebration in 1992 commemorating the [...]
